The cheapest way to get from Moissac to Montpellier is to train and bus which costs €30 - €60 and takes 4h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Moissac to Montpellier is to drive which takes 2h 54m and costs €45 - €70.
No, there is no direct train from Moissac to Montpellier. However, there are services departing from Moissac and arriving at Montpellier Saint-Roch via Montauban Ville Bourbon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 9m.
The distance between Moissac and Montpellier is 326 km. The road distance is 309.3 km.
The best way to get from Moissac to Montpellier without a car is to train which takes 4h 9m and costs €35 - €80.
It takes approximately 4h 9m to get from Moissac to Montpellier, including transfers.
Moissac to Montpellier train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), depart from Montauban Ville Bourbon station.
Moissac to Montpellier train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), arrive at Montpellier Saint-Roch station.
Yes, the driving distance between Moissac to Montpellier is 309 km. It takes approximately 2h 54m to drive from Moissac to Montpellier.
